#Epic Chain - Background & History
Epic Chain is a Layer 2 blockchain platform that originated from Ethernity Chain (ERN) - a well-known project focused on authenticated NFTs(aNFTs).In 2024,the Ethernity team initiated a strategic transformation to expand their ecosystem beyond NFTs by introducing Epic Chain, aiming to support broader real-world asset (RWA) tokenization, AI-driven digital rights management and entertainment integrations.
Timeline Overview -
2021–2023 -
Ethernity Chain gained popularity by launching celebrity NFTs and forming partnerships with global artists and athletes.
Late 2023 -
The team recognized limitations in scalability and use-case diversity with ERN. Plans for a Layer 2 solution began.
Early 2024 -
The Epic Chain project was announced, rebranding from Ethernity to reflect a broader vision. It retained the EVM-compatible nature and integrated support for AI-enhanced tools.
Mid 2024 -
EPIC token launched to replace ERN in the ecosystem. Migration tools were provided to ERN holders.
2025 -
Epic Chain got listed on Binance, expanding its reach and making it more accessible. It started to support tokenized entertainment assets, creator economies, and real-world assets.
Core Vision
Epic Chain aims to bridge real-world value and blockchain utility, especially for creators, brands, and entertainment industries, while offering secure and scalable tools through its Layer 2 infrastructure.
